Inpatient detoxification is vital when someone is withdrawing from substance use due to the fact that withdrawal can be dangerous. While in an inpatient detoxification facility in Warnock clients can be closely observed for symptoms of drug or alcohol withdrawal which could cause health complications or even death in more severe cases. Someone suffering with alcoholism for example would need to be closely monitored and likely given certain medications which would prevent seizures and delirium tremens. Benzodiazepine withdrawal is another type of drug that could bring about very similar symptoms, and medical professionals in the inpatient detoxification center will keep them safe.

There is not an exact practice for each person in detoxification, because of the unique differences that each person presents when entering detox. An individual who is otherwise in good health may be in detox for 4 or 5 days and be released without much medical intervention, while a different patient may require comprehensive treatment and medical intervention for 7 to 10 days or more. Health safety is of the greatest concern, and also a transition to treatment for individuals who need to go to an actual drug and alcohol rehab program once detox is complete. Many detox facilities collaborate with drug treatment facilities to make this transition possible, since detoxification is only the first step in an overall rehabilitation plan for recovering addicts.
